These can be found for less than a $100 on eBone these days, but you have to admit they're sloppily put together. The Wilkinsons are alnico and wax potted and not at all bad (I made a pair of great double jazz humbuckers out of spares I pulled.) Bridges need to go, control route needs shielding, p'ups too if you want to reduce noise to minimum. It's a weird decision to put a fat PBass neck on a jazz tho, and a bad decision to leave the fingerboard unfinished. They're Cort necks. I work these and bring them up to easily playable but if I were buying a budget bass for a kid or I relied on a luthier I'd choose something much closer to finished and more closely spec'd to an actual Jazz.

@@RumblinMan They're great for teaching yourself luthier skills but you're right they come with built in struggles. Look at the grain structure on the maple necks and finger boards-- it looks they're likely made from large branches, not the tree trunk. I take almost 1/8" off the back and reshape them and they stay straight but over time I'm sure the necks will become unstable. Out of 3 I have 2 that have 2 sets of bridge screw holes drilled (each) and 3 of 3 had bridges out of center. So, if you want to learn how to overdrill and fill misaligned holes with hardwood dowel and set a bridge from scratch all of mine are great! 😆 The sunburst I most recently bought got a Chender bound rosewood block inlay $70 jazz neck which was heavenly compared to the maple Pbass neck, even with the fret level it needed.
